
One of the best-selling video games of all time is making the leap to next-gen! The hit Grand Theft Auto V, developed by Rockstar Games, utilizes the technology of the new generation of consoles to make Los Santos even more beautiful and realistic. The adventures of Michael, Franklin, and Trevor in the game world inspired by Southern California weave a cohesive story, where players can engage in a wide range of criminal activities and rise from petty criminals to millionaires. All the typical features of the GTA series are present: the cars, the freedom of movement, the missions, and all the little details that fans love about the GTA games. Just bigger, better, and more of it. Welcome to Los Santos and welcome to next-gen.

For example the cars have ... MoreSo this is surprisingly the hardest review I've had to do for a long time. It's easy to jump on the bandwagon and just say GTA V is the greatest game ever, but it isn't without its flaws. Not saying its not a great game, but perfect, is is far from.For starters the story is very good and it is quite long, but being forced into side missions and the linearity of it can get boring, although the main missions can more than make up for this. The graphics are pretty much at the peak of what the consoles are capable of and they look amazing for the most part, up close they still show a little bit blurry, but they've done well with the performance of the hardware.The physics engine is really in depth but it can be times a little overdone. For example the cars have damage from individual panels, glass, tyres, axels, rims, suspension, engine, transmission and brakes, nearing simulation levels. But if you try to climb something that's just outside of your limits (a non-climbable object, a fence thats slightly too high, a bank thats just a little too steep, etc.) you'll find yourself ragdolling unrealistically.The AI can be really bad as vehicles will randomly change lanes and ram you off, or into things. The police seem to have vector aim at all times as they move to your exact location even when they don't know where you are, and they will even change course to follow you even if they don't know you have changed direction (you can see them do it on the mini map), they shoot directly at you even if you're behind cover, in fact the easiest way to avoid them is to move off road because cops are inclined not to leave the road unless they have you in line of sight, making it near impossible to escape when helicopters chase you.The amount of content in this game is very high with (according to the wiki) over 250 vehicles, with more to come via DLC. Weapons are customisable to an extent: (extended clip, flashlight, suppressor, scope, tints). Vehicles are also customisable: (armour, bodykit parts, brakes, engine, exhaust, suspension, etc.). You can make investments such as the share market, and buying properties for extra cash. There are also a bunch of mini games and collectables to keep you occupied for a while.The online mode works okay but the unnecessary, unskippable tutorial is a real pain. Also as you start out, you will find yourself at a major disadvantage against others who have massive weapon and armour advantages (e.g. They have advanced rifles with scopes and full body armour, you have a pistol and no armour, well balanced Rockstar...). You create your online character from scratch with appearance, base stats, outfit, etc. Rockstar have stated that heists and other content (Custom game creation, vehicles, weapons, mini missions, etc.) will come for GTA online as both free and paid DLC at a later date.All and all it's a good game and worth playing even if only for the single player story, but repetism and little glitches can at times ruin the experience.

Grand Theft Auto V - Xbox 360 is a very good game that has tons of content within it. The area that you can explore within the game is larger than all the other previous Grand Theft Auto games combined. The game centers around three characters Michael, Trevor, and Franklin. The game allows you to eventually jump between the characters and do missions that are exclusively tied to that character's storyline.The game is dense and looks beautiful. You will definitely get your money's worth with this game. You can probably put in over a 100 hours of gameplay if you want to. There is so much that you can do within the game, for example you can go to a movie theater within the game and watch a short movie about a british robot who curses.
